With a crisp professional look, Maurice H. Joseph real estate in Jackson, Mississippi has a great new look after their site renovation. The site now contains much more informative and useful information as well as their property listings directly on the site.
The back-end content managment system was custom built to handle agent profiles and property listings as well as the regular content. It allows for easy update and maintenance of property information and images, as well as an easy way to highlight specific listings on the home page.

The modern gothic theme of the Eternal Body Art site sets a dark, mysterious mood that appeals to the tattoo shop's customer base. This can be clearly demonstrated by viewing the sites two Flash photo gallerys of client tattoos and piercings.
The directions page uses Google Maps API to allow customers to view an interactive map of the shop. The entire site uses a fluid or scalable layout meaning the page will expand or shrink to fill the browser window on any size monitor or screen resolution.

The giant tepee shaped building painted with native american designs set the tone for this site. The restaurant sits along side a passenger railroad and the train does indeed stop to eat there. All of the graphics were hand drawn by yours truly including the train, train tracks, the open sign on the contact page, and the map to the restaurant on the contact page.
The site also contains images of every native american tribal flag in their massive collection, their menu, a web e-mail form, and 3D tour of the inside of the tepee.

The Conscious Living Project is completely database driven and used to organize volunteers for local Jackson, MS area projects. Apart from the CMS, the site has a user registration system, event management system where users can volunteer for different activites, a custom web forum, and an event calendar.
